Prior to the opening of the waste water plant, around 1963, [1] the waste in San Diego was carried through interconnected wooden boxes. These boxes transported the water to the San Diego River and then on to the ocean. The cost of water from the plant will be $100 to $200 more per acre-foot than recycled water (approximately 0.045 cents per gallon), $1,000 to $1,100 more than reservoir water (approx. 0.32 cents per gallon), but $100 to $200 less than importing water from outside the county. [42] As of April 2015, San Diego County imported 90% of its water. [13]
Water fluoridation is the most cost-effective way to induce fluoride, with an estimated cost between US$0.50 and $3.00 per person per year, depending on the size of the community involved. [33] A dollar spent on fluoridating water is estimated to save $7–42 on dental treatment. [33]
Cetylpyridinium chloride is known to cause tooth staining in approximately 3 percent of users. [14] The Crest brand has noted that this staining is actually an indication that the product is working as intended, as the stains are a result of bacteria dying on the teeth. [15]

Back teeth showing fissure system. Dental caries is an upset of the balance between loss and gain of minerals from a tooth surface. [3] The loss of minerals from the teeth occurs from the bacteria within the mouth, fermenting foods and producing acids, whereas the tooth gains minerals from our saliva and fluoride that is present within the mouth. Atraumatic restorative treatment (ART) [1] is a method for cleaning out tooth decay (dental caries) from teeth using only hand instruments (dental hatchet and spoon-excavator) and placing a filling. It does not use rotary dental instruments ( dental drills ) to prepare the tooth and can be performed in settings with no access to dental equipment.
In dentistry, debridement refers to the removal by dental cleaning of accumulations of plaque and calculus (tartar) in order to maintain dental health.
